    Need advice on maintenance

    Hi Guys,

    I have a 2000 WS6 (AT) with about 36,000 miles. I bought it brand-new back in November 1999.

    Anyway, as you can see, I put very little mileage on it. Thus, I am never sure as to how often I should get it serviced.

    How often should I do a regular Lube/Oil/Filter service????

    How often should I have all the other stuff serviced?? For example: transmission flush, cooling system flush, fuel injection service, replace fuel filter, power steering fluid flush, brake fluid flush, engine flush, etc.

    I guess all that stuff would fall under the 30K, 60K, 90K, etc. services. But, since I don't put much mileage on the car, I don't know which services to do and how often they should be done.
